Seite 1 von 1

Biblatex - unterschiedliche Versionen im admin und user mode

Verfasst: Mi 4. Apr 2018, 16:20
von mushroom20
Hallo,

ich habe folgendes Problem. Nach einem heutigen update von MiKTeX, geht mein Literaturverzeichnis nicht mehr. Ich erhalte folgenden Fehlermeldung in TeXnicCenter
ERROR - Error: Found biblatex control file version 3.3, expected version 3.4.
This means that your biber (2.11) and biblatex (3.7) versions are incompatible.
Im Package manager von MiKTeX konnte ich herausfinden, dass im Admin mode biblatex (3.11) installiert ist und im user mode biblatex (3.7) installiert sind. In beiden modes ist biber (2.11) installiert. Leider lässt sich im user mode biblatex nicht weiter updaten.

'Refresh file name database' hat leider nichts gebracht, ebensowenig der update check. Wie kommt es zu den beiden unterschiedlichen Versionen und wie lassen sich beide modes (admin und user) angleichen bzw. wie zwinge ich TeXnicCenter die Admin-Version von MiKTeX zu verwenden?

Markus

Verfasst: Mi 4. Apr 2018, 16:29
von Gast
Mhhh, biblatex sollte sich im User-Modus aktualisieren lassen, wenn es nicht aktuell ist. Du könntest natürlich auch versuchen, die User-Version von biblatex zu deinstallieren, dann wird die Admin-Version genutzt.

Hast Du denn schon die MikTeX Console oder noch eine ältere Version mit separatem Package Manager und MikTeX Update?

Was genau hast Du versucht, um das Paket zu aktualisieren und was ist passiert? Bekommst Du Fehlermeldungen, passiert einfach nichts? Idealerweise zeigst Du uns Schritt für Schritt, was Du getan hast (mit der Antwort von MikTeX entweder in Textform oder als Screenshot.)

Verfasst: Mi 4. Apr 2018, 17:05
von mushroom20
Hallo,

ich habe bereits die neue MiKTeX Console. Deinem Rat folgend habe ich versucht biblatex zu deinstallieren. Im user mode war dies leider nicht möglich, da das Symbol mit dem '-' nicht aktiv war. Im Admin mode war ich erfolgreich.

Dann wieder neu installiert. Zuerst im user mode inkl. 'Refresh file name database'. Diesmal wurde die aktuellste Version biblatex (3.11) installiert - geprüft mit Rechtsklick und Package properties. Im TeXnicCenter taucht weiterhin die Fehlermeldung auf.

Ebenfalls im admin mode installiert, auch biblatex (3.11) inkl. 'Refresh file name database'. Aber auch hier zeigt TeXnicCenter weiter die Fehlermeldung an.

Darum mal manuell in der Kommandozeile biber ausgeführt mit demselben Resultat wie bei TeXnicCenter.

Habe dann die gleiche Prozedur mit biber wiederholt. Das Problem besteht leider weiter.

Verfasst: Mi 4. Apr 2018, 17:34
von Gast
Neuen `pdflatex`-Lauf hast Du vor dem Aufruf von `biber` gemacht?
Kontrolliere mal in der log-Datei von wo `biblatex` tatsächlich geladen wird. Vielleicht liegt da noch irgendwo eine alte Version herum, die zuerst gefunden wird.

Verfasst: Mi 4. Apr 2018, 19:43
von mushroom20
Neuer pdflatex-Lauf (bzw. bei mir latex-dvips-ps2pdf) war noch der Knackpunkt. Jetzt läuft's wie gewünscht. Danke für die schnelle und kompetente Hilfe.